New York Jets' Core Players Eye Major Contract Extensions

The New York Jets are gearing up for a crucial offseason as cornerback Sauce Gardner and wide receiver Garrett Wilson become eligible for their first contract extensions. Both players, entering their fourth NFL season, have established themselves as foundational pieces for the franchise.

Key Insights

  1. Foundational Players in Focus:

    • Newly-hired head coach Aaron Glenn has already reached out to both Gardner and Wilson, signaling their importance to the team’s future.
    • General Manager Darren Mougey has expressed his intent to retain top talent, emphasizing the importance of keeping young stars in the fold.
    • "The to-do list is to keep good young players on the team and add good players," Mougey stated during the NFL scouting combine.
  2. Timing is Everything:

    • While players drafted in the first round are under contract for four years (with a fifth-year option), extensions are typically negotiated after the third season.
    • Recent league trends show a shift towards earlier extensions for elite cornerbacks and wide receivers, as seen with Pat Surtain II ($96 million) and Jaylen Waddle ($85 million).
    • Gardner’s desire to remain a Jet for his entire career could influence negotiations, while Wilson’s consistent performance makes him a top priority.
  3. League Comparisons:

    • Gardner’s potential extension draws parallels to Surtain’s deal, given Mougey’s involvement in the Broncos’ negotiations.
    • At wide receiver, Wilson’s production aligns with recent extensions for players like Justin Jefferson ($140 million) and CeeDee Lamb ($136 million).
  4. Jets’ Offseason Strategy:

    • The Jets are resetting their quarterback depth chart following the departure of Aaron Rodgers, with Jordan Travis emerging as a potential wild card.
    • Mougey and Glenn have set a tone of urgency, emphasizing a "win-now" mentality despite the team’s 5-12 record in 2024.
  5. Roster Expectations:

    • The Jets’ leadership is focused on immediate success, aiming to break a 14-year playoff drought.
    • Fans will be watching closely to see how aggressive the team is in free agency and the draft.
